During the general election campaign, president-elect Barack Obama dealt with rumors about his religious background, birth place and supposed "palling around with terrorists." But the Obama campaign never faltered, and it seemed as thought nothing could knock him off his stride. This Saturday Night Live sketch identifies what no rumor could undercut: Obama's remaining "cool" under pressure.
